Bihar ·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 1977
Ram Sharan Yadav of Independent won the Khagaria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Bihar in the 1977 state assembly election, securing 20,289 votes (34.50% vote share). The runner-up was Ram Pravesh Pd. Singh (Communist Party Of India) with 12,254 votes.
A total of 9 candidates contested this assembly seat. State Assembly elections elect Members of the Legislative Assembly (MLAs) using India's First-Past-The-Post (FPTP) system, and the party or alliance winning a majority of seats forms the state government. Full candidate-wise vote breakdown, vote shares, and constituency information are shown below.
| Position | Candidate Name | Votes | Votes% | Party |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Ram Sharan Yadav | 20289 | 34.50% | Independent |
| 2 | Ram Pravesh Pd. Singh | 12254 | 20.90% | Communist Party Of India |
| 3 | Ram Bhadur Azad | 11580 | 19.70% | Independent |
| 4 | Anandi Prasad Singh | 8522 | 14.50% | Communist Party Of India (MARXIST) |
| 5 | Kedar Naryan Singh Azad | 3807 | 6.50% | Independent |
| 6 | Naresh Chandra Verma | 1366 | 2.30% | Independent |
| 7 | Nirmala Devi | 333 | 0.60% | Independent |
| 8 | Ravindra Kumar Singh | 306 | 0.50% | Independent |
| 9 | Dinesh Kumar | 297 | 0.50% | Independent |
